Tardelli looks at the next 3

Last updated : 26 March 2009 By Paul Jennings
Marco Tardelli thinks that the Republic of Ireland will be either in a dogfight or pole position by June. The Irish assistant coach feels that the next three group games will leave us in no doubt as to where we are in the qualifying process.

The Republic of Ireland face Bulgaria on Saturday, before the dangerous trip to Bari, Italy on Wednesday night. Our next fixture is the second round against Bulgaria in June in a stadium where Irish teams have had little or no luck in the past.

Tardelli said on www.independent.ie

"We have three matches that are very important," "We have Bulgaria, Italy, and Bulgaria. Three matches for South Africa. It's possible."
